如何阐明生成引用现有文档的文档 xsd
How to have enunciate generate documentation referencing existing xsd
我正在使用 enunciate 2.6.0 生成 jax-rs 服务的文档。对于第一种方法,我使用自定义 MessageBodyWriter
序列化为 xml。我有一个描述响应的 xsd 文件。是否可以指出该架构文档?默认情况下,enunciate 生成一个基本为空的 ns0.xsd。
wiki 中的这个 page 似乎描述了配置现有模式的能力。我已对其进行配置,以便它找到本地 xsd 文件(如果找不到它,构建将失败),但生成的文档仍然没有引用它。我认为问题在于从方法返回的对象和 xml 类型似乎没有联系。
看来关键是在 idl schema 配置值中使用默认命名空间,即使在运行时使用了 "real" 命名空间。
我正在使用 enunciate 2.6.0 生成 jax-rs 服务的文档。对于第一种方法,我使用自定义 MessageBodyWriter
序列化为 xml。我有一个描述响应的 xsd 文件。是否可以指出该架构文档?默认情况下,enunciate 生成一个基本为空的 ns0.xsd。
wiki 中的这个 page 似乎描述了配置现有模式的能力。我已对其进行配置,以便它找到本地 xsd 文件(如果找不到它,构建将失败),但生成的文档仍然没有引用它。我认为问题在于从方法返回的对象和 xml 类型似乎没有联系。
看来关键是在 idl schema 配置值中使用默认命名空间,即使在运行时使用了 "real" 命名空间。